二维码溯源系统是一项复杂的技术项目,它旨在通过为产品或服务赋予一个唯一的二维码标识,来追踪其整个生命周期中的每一步。这种系统通常包括数据采集、存储、处理和展示等环节,需要对工作量进行评估以确保项目的顺利进行。以下是对二维码溯源系统工作量的评估:
一、需求分析与规划
1. 需求调研:在项目初期,需要进行深入的需求调研,了解不同利益相关者(如生产商、分销商、零售商等)的具体需求。这包括了解他们对溯源信息的关注点、期望的功能以及数据格式要求。
2. 系统设计:根据需求分析的结果,设计出满足所有需求的系统架构。这涉及到选择合适的技术栈、确定数据库结构、设计用户界面等。
3. 功能规划:明确系统应具备哪些核心功能,如数据采集、数据传输、数据处理和结果展示等。同时,还需要规划如何实现这些功能,包括技术选型、接口定义等。
4. 时间规划:制定详细的项目时间表,包括各个阶段的开始和结束时间、关键里程碑以及预期的交付物。这有助于确保项目按计划进行,并能够及时调整以应对可能出现的问题。
二、数据采集与管理
1. 数据采集:在产品生产、运输、销售等各个环节中,都需要采集相应的数据。例如,在生产过程中,可以通过传感器收集设备运行状态、环境参数等信息;在运输过程中,可以通过GPS定位获取车辆位置信息;在销售过程中,可以通过扫描二维码获取产品信息等。
2. 数据存储:将采集到的数据存储在数据库中,以便后续的处理和查询。这需要考虑数据的完整性、安全性和可扩展性等因素。
3. 数据管理:对存储的数据进行有效的管理,包括数据的清洗、去重、排序等操作。这有助于提高数据的准确性和可用性。
三、数据处理与分析
1. 数据分析:对采集到的数据进行分析,提取有价值的信息。例如,可以分析产品的使用情况、故障率等指标,从而为改进产品提供依据。
2. 模型建立:根据分析结果,建立相应的预测模型或分类模型。这有助于更好地理解产品性能,并为未来的决策提供支持。
3. 结果展示:将分析结果以直观的方式展示给用户,如通过图表、报表等形式呈现。这有助于用户快速了解产品状况,并做出相应的决策。
四、系统集成与测试
1. 系统集成:将各个模块集成在一起,形成一个完整的二维码溯源系统。这需要确保各个模块之间的数据能够正确传递和处理。
2. 系统测试:对集成后的系统进行全面的测试,包括单元测试、集成测试和系统测试等。这有助于发现系统中存在的问题,并及时进行修复。
3. 性能优化:根据测试结果,对系统进行性能优化,提高系统的响应速度和稳定性。
五、培训与上线
1. 用户培训:对用户进行培训,帮助他们熟悉系统的使用方法和注意事项。这有助于提高用户的满意度和使用效率。
2. 系统上线:在确保系统稳定运行后,将其正式投入使用。这需要做好相关的准备工作,如数据迁移、系统切换等。
3. 持续维护:在系统上线后,还需要对其进行持续的维护和更新,以适应不断变化的需求和技术环境。
综上所述,二维码溯源系统的工作量评估是一个系统性的过程,需要从多个方面进行考虑和规划。通过合理的需求分析与规划、数据采集与管理、数据处理与分析、系统集成与测试以及培训与上线等工作,可以确保二维码溯源系统的顺利实施和高效运行。